Hi everybody

I picked up a little heater at a garage sale this summer. it has a thermostat and a fan in it. It is small enough to mount to the wall in my coop. I was thinking about mounting it through the wall from the outside and building a little cage to go around it inside the coop. Does anyone think that is a good or bad idea?

Thanks!
hmm.png
 
Bad idea.

1. Chickens do not need winter heat.

2. Chicken dust = fire hazzard.

Dont do it.
